Saturday is National Trails Day, a single day devoted to connecting users with all the trail possibilities in their area whether they are new or regular visitors. There are related trail events across Minnesota. Find some at American Hiking Society's website. A sampling:

Fergus Falls: North Country Trail (NCT) grand opening celebration, Prairie Wetlands Learning Center, 1-5 p.m. Saturday, official opening of the 9.8-mile NCT loop within the city, scheduled hikes, bit.ly/nctday

Inver Grove Heights: Trail hike (about 2 miles), Harmon Park Reserve, 10 a.m. Saturday, register at invergroveheights.org or 651-450-2585

Fridley: Third annual Bike & Hike, Riverview Heights Park, 9 a.m. Saturday

Castle Danger: Superior Hiking Trail, two guided hikes from trailhead, 10 a.m.-3 p.m. Saturday, shta.org/news-events

Deer River: Hike, Simpson Creek trail, Cut Foot Sioux Visitor Center, 1 p.m. Saturday, 1-218-335-8600
